ALOR SETAR, Kedah - A 4m-long python was captured by Malaysia’s Civil Defence Force team after it swallowed a large goat on Oct 31.
The incident took place at Kampung Poko Setol, in Kedah’s south-eastern Baling district.
Baling civil defence officer Mohd Faizol Ab Aziz said the capture was challenging, as the snake had retreated into a pond after consuming the goat near a pen.
“We faced difficulties capturing it because the snake swam into the pond after eating the goat,” he said.
Lieutenant Mohd Faizol said a member of the public called the team at 8am on Oct 31 to alert them of the incident.
Team members managed to capture the 35kg python within 20 minutes.
Lt Mohd Faizol advised villagers to contact the Civil Defence Force or other relevant agencies if they encounter dangerous reptiles.
